Job Description

AEM Revenue Accounting AR Manager

Job Type: Full time

**Description**

AEM (Advanced Environmental Monitoring) is the global leader in innovative mission critical weather, wildfire, and water monitoring and intelligence solutions. We aim to be the world's essential source for environmental insights, enabling decisive action and positive outcomes for our customers and their constituents. Our family of innovators offers world-class hydrometeorological technologies and services, including sensors, dataloggers, telemetry, and advanced analytics and software. Our technology and services empower the communities and organizations to survive and thrive in the face of escalating environmental risks.

The Revenue Accounting and AR Manager will be part of AEM's Finance team and is responsible for ensuring the accurate reporting of revenue and relevant accounting data, performing technical accounting research related to revenue, ensuring compliance of the Company's revenue accounting policies, and providing leadership and training for the three accounting professionals reporting into this role. This individual will work closely with senior management in Customer Success, Sales, Marketing, Legal, and cross-functionally within Finance. In addition, they will work closely with external auditors to facilitate the year-end audits, as well as on an ad hoc basis to resolve complex accounting issues associated with revenue accounting. **Job Responsibilities**

  • Manage and oversee the daily operations of Revenue Accounting and Billings/Accounts Receivable
  • Apply revenue recognition policy to contracts
  • Manage Project to Cash and Order to Cash while driving process improvements across the business
  • Execute and manage the monthly close process for revenue-related areas (revenue, accounts receivable, unbilled receivables, deferred revenue, deferred COGS, etc.) in NetSuite, including account reconciliations
  • Monitor relevant US GAAP developments to ensure the company's revenue recognition policies and procedures are compliant
  • Perform contract analysis reviews and document reviews following ASC 606 Accounting Standards
  • Prepare technical revenue accounting memos in compliance with US GAAP
  • Perform gross margin analysis and assist in analyzing budget variances
  • Manage calculation of commissions for Sales team
  • Manage Avalara AvaTax and CertCapture and Sales-Use tax compliance and state filings
  • Support AOP and budgeting activities
  • Work diligently on finding solutions to critical issues, lead special projects as needed, and drive issues/projects to successful completion
  • Mentor direct reports to establish goals and objectives for each year and monitor and advise on the progress to enhance the professional development of staff

**Requirements**

  • Bachelor's degree in accounting
  • 10 years of progressively responsible accounting experience, preferably in a combination of public accounting and corporate accounting, preferably with private equity-backed companies
  • Strong understanding of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), the ability to research technical accounting literature, and apply such guidance to new and existing transactions
  • Five or more years of supervisory experience preferred
  • CPA or MBA preferred
  • Highly proficient in Excel
  • Experience with NetSuite and system-generated revenue arrangements a plus
  • Self-starter with the ability to work independently and remotely
  • Ability to manage globally dispersed teams
  • Experience with both software development and manufacturing environments
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
